What to do in Tulum is now a destination center for tourists from throughout the world. It offers beautiful sandy beaches with warm turquoise waters, well-preserved archaeological site, very rich ancient and contemporaneous Maya culture, great biodiversity in flora and fauna, delicious homemade Mexican/Maya food, and much more.

What to do in Tulum is located on the eastern side of the Yucatan Peninsula, in the Mexican state of Quintana Roo. In the heart of the Riviera Maya on the Caribbean Sea. Tulum is adjacent to the Mesoamerican Barrier Reef, the second-longest coral reef system in the world, what makes the turquoise Caribbean waters and the white sand beaches.

What to do in Tulum is home to dozens of beautiful cenotes and caverns, many of which provide excellent diving experiences. As you dive into these deep underwater sinkholes, you’ll experience a magical play of light and shadow and see millions of limestone formations, fossils, prehistoric bone formations, marine life, and halocline.

What to do in Tulum offer this biosphere reserve covers 10% of the whole state of Quintana Roo and contains tropical forests, mangroves and marshes, as well as a large marine section intersected by a barrier reef. It provides a habitat for a remarkably rich flora and a fauna.
